Test positivity rate at 24.1%; active caseload falls to 45,405
A total of 3,219 people tested positive for SARS-CoV-2 in Ernakulam on Saturday. The test positivity rate stands at 24.1% and 13,307 tests were done. The district’s active caseload has fallen to 45,405. The figure was at 68,357 on May 16, roughly a week ago. Sreemoolanagaram recorded the highest number of new cases with 113 people testing positive, followed by Thrikkakara with 107 and Thripunithura with 80 new cases. Palluruthy registered 78 new cases, Kumbalangi 68, Payipra 67, Udayamperoor 63, Fort Kochi 62, Choornikkara and Mulavukad 61 each, and Mattancherry 60. Nine health workers, one police officer and two CISF personnel have tested positive.More Related News
